CMS Connector — Integration Guide

This document explains how to integrate the CMS Connector into a TypeScript project, with a example on Next.js with Directus. The pattern is simple: create a single shared instance (e.g., cmsInstance.ts) and reuse it across your application.

What you get

  • A typed interface to read and (optionally) write content to your CMS.
  • First-class Directus support via cmsType: "directus".
  • Strong TypeScript types for resources, dictionaries, and configuration.

Quick start (create a shared instance)

Create a file such as src/lib/cms/cmsInstance.ts and export a single shared instance. This instance can be imported wherever you need to access the CMS.

import { CmsFactory } from "cms-connector";

const cmsInstance = CmsFactory.createResource({
  cmsType: "directus",
  configuration: {
    languages: ["it"],
    url: process.env.FRONTEND_CMS_URL as string,
    // staticToken: process.env.DIRECTUS_STATIC_TOKEN, // optional; required only for write operations
  },
});

export default cmsInstance;

Environment variables (example for Next.js .env):

FRONTEND_CMS_URL=https://your-directus.example.com
# DIRECTUS_STATIC_TOKEN=your-static-token  # optional, only if you need write/patch/upload

Keep tokens server-side only; never expose them to the browser.


Using the instance in Next.js (App Router)

You can import the shared instance into Server Components, Route Handlers, and Server Actions.

Example: Server Component

// app/(site)/page.tsx
import cms from "@/lib/cms/cmsInstance";

export default async function HomePage() {
  const page = await cms.getResource({
    entityName: "page",
    language: "it",
    queryParameters: {
      filter: { slug: { _eq: "home" } },
      limit: 1,
    },
    includeDraft: false,
  });

  if (!page) return <div>Not found</div>;
  return <main>{page.title}</main>;
}

Example: Route Handler

// app/api/pages/[slug]/route.ts
import cms from "@/lib/cms/cmsInstance";
import { NextResponse } from "next/server";

export async function GET(_: Request, { params }: { params: { slug: string } }) {
  const page = await cms.getResource({
    entityName: "page",
    language: "it",
    queryParameters: { filter: { slug: { _eq: params.slug } }, limit: 1 },
    includeDraft: false,
    // Pass Next.js caching hints if needed via fetchOptions (see below)
  });

  return NextResponse.json(page ?? null);
}

Caching with fetchOptions

All read methods accept an optional fetchOptions?: RequestInit, which Next.js understands for caching and revalidation:

await cms.getResources({
  entityName: "page",
  language: "it",
  queryParameters: { limit: 10 },
  includeDraft: false,
  fetchOptions: { next: { revalidate: 60 } }, // ISR every 60 seconds
});

Using the instance in any TypeScript project

The same instance pattern works in any Node/TypeScript setup (e.g., Express, server-side scripts):

import cms from "./cmsInstance";

async function main() {
  const dictionary = await cms.getDictionary({ language: "it" });
  console.log(dictionary);
}

main().catch(console.error);

Read API overview

These are the main read methods you will use (types are strongly inferred from the underlying Directus schema):

  • getResource({ entityName, language, queryParameters, includeDraft, fetchOptions })
  • getResources({ entityName, language, queryParameters, includeDraft, fetchOptions })
  • getResourceById({ entityName, id, language, queryParameters, fetchOptions })
  • getResourcesCount({ entityName, filterParameters, fetchOptions })
  • getDictionary({ language, fetchOptions })
  • getConfiguration({ language, fetchOptions })

Notes:

  • If you configured languages in the instance, passing a language that is not in the allowed list will throw an error.
  • includeDraft toggles draft-vs-published behavior where supported.
  • queryParameters and filterParameters mirror Directus query shapes.

Write API (optional, requires static token)

To use write operations, provide a staticToken in the configuration. Keep it server-side only.

  • uploadFile({ formData })
  • createResource({ entityName, item })
  • patchResource({ id, entityName, item })

Example (Server Action / Route Handler only):

import cms from "@/lib/cms/cmsInstance";

export async function createExample() {
  const id = await cms.createResource({
    entityName: "page",
    item: { title: "Hello" },
  });
  return id;
}

Configuration reference

When using Directus, the factory expects:

CmsFactory.createResource({
  cmsType: "directus",
  configuration: {
    url: string;                      // required
    staticToken?: string;             // optional (required for write ops)
    languages?: readonly string[];    // optional (enables language guard)
  },
});

Currently supported cmsType values:

  • "directus"

Project structure recommendation

  • Create a shared instance file, e.g. src/lib/cms/cmsInstance.ts.
  • Reuse the exported instance everywhere (Server Components, Route Handlers, services).
  • Keep CMS environment variables in .env.local (Next.js) or your server env.

Troubleshooting

  • “Unknown CMS type …”: Ensure cmsType is exactly "directus".
  • “Missing or invalid language”: If you configured languages, pass only those values to read methods.
  • Write methods throwing: Provide staticToken in configuration; use them only on the server.
  • Network issues: Verify FRONTEND_CMS_URL points to the correct Directus REST endpoint.
